03/15/2015: GUCCI UPDATE

Gucci has blossomed in rescue! He is very smart, very sweet and very handsome!...and has gained over 20 pounds! He came into rescue at about 48 pounds, he currently weighs 72 pounds! His coat, once stained brown from urine and waste, is now nice and white!

01/25/15: A Sinful Case Of Neglect

New Hampshire Police are searching for any information leading to the abuser/s of a timid, emaciated male dog that was discovered walking on the side of a road over the weekend of December 9, 2014.

The skeletal, neglected dog was not wearing any type of identification and it is surmised that he was abandoned. Aside from his glaringly horrendous physical condition (lack of body fat), this poor dog showed other signs of neglect which included grossly overgrown nails and an unkempt coat stained with urine and feces...all indicators that he was kept confined to a small space ( i.e. crate or outside dog house/kennel).

This poor soul was kept in quarantine for 14 days and then kenneled for an additional 17 days at which time we received a call asking for our help. We quickly made arrangements for this sad looking boy to come into our Rescue program and one of our volunteers went to pick him up the following day.

The first order of business besides giving him lots of reassurance was a nice warm bath. So far he has been a sweet cooperative young man. He is enjoying the companionship of other dogs, snuggling in a warm bed and relishing good food. We will have more information in the days to follow.
